Jun 20 10:10:17 knot knot[820911]: fatal error: concurrent map iteration and map write Jun 20 10:10:17 knot knot[820911]: goroutine 68 [running]: Jun 20 10:10:17 knot knot[820911]: internal/runtime/maps.fatal({0x117e0b2?, 0xc000069530?}) Jun 20 10:10:17 knot knot[820911]: runtime/panic.go:1058 +0x18 Jun 20 10:10:17 knot knot[820911]: internal/runtime/maps.(*Iter).Next(0xc00746da68?) Jun 20 10:10:17 knot knot[820911]: internal/runtime/maps/table.go:683 +0x86 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5/storage/filesystem.(*ObjectStorage).findObjectInPackfile(0xc007a7ad38, {0x5, 0xb5, 0xc3, 0x9f, 0xd5, 0x7a, 0xe1, 0xf6, 0x4d, ...})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5@v5.14.0/storage/filesystem/object.go:559 +0xc5 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5/storage/filesystem.(*ObjectStorage).getFromPackfile(0xc007a7ad38, {0x5, 0xb5, 0xc3, 0x9f, 0xd5, 0x7a, 0xe1, 0xf6, 0x4d, ...}, ...)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5@v5.14.0/storage/filesystem/object.go:479 +0x85 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5/storage/filesystem.(*ObjectStorage).EncodedObject(0xc007a7ad38, 0x1, {0x5, 0xb5, 0xc3, 0x9f, 0xd5, 0x7a, 0xe1, 0xf6, ...})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5@v5.14.0/storage/filesystem/object.go:350 +0x54 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5/plumbing/object.GetCommit({0x173dc68, 0xc007a7ad20}, {0x5, 0xb5, 0xc3, 0x9f, 0xd5, 0x7a, 0xe1, 0xf6, ...})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5@v5.14.0/plumbing/object/commit.go:73 +0x39 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5.(*Repository).CommitObject(...)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5@v5.14.0/repository.go:1447 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/git.(*GitRepo).Commit(0xc007afa860?, {0x5, 0xb5, 0xc3, 0x9f, 0xd5, 0x7a, 0xe1, 0xf6, 0x4d, ...})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/git/git.go:192 +0x65 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/git.(*GitRepo).Branches.func1(0xc007c54c80)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/git/git.go:338 +0x189 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5/plumbing/storer.(*referenceFilteredIter).ForEach(0xc007aae288, 0xc007ab7cb0) Jun 20 10:10:17 knot knot[820911]: github.com/go-git/go-git/v5@v5.14.0/plumbing/storer/reference.go:82 +0xbb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/git.(*GitRepo).Branches(0xc007ab6990)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/git/git.go:332 +0x127 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ver.(*Handle).RepoIndex.func3()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/routes.go:129 +0x5d Jun 20 10:10:17 knot knot[820911]: created by tangled.sh/tangled.sh/core/knotserver.(*Handle).RepoIndex in goroutine 64 Jun 20 10:10:17 knot knot[820911]: tangled.sh/tangled.sh/core/knotserver/routes.go:127 +0x72f